Green is More Than Just a Color in the Art Business
With the emphasis on “going green” on most people’s minds these days, Nadine and Glenn’s Original Lobster Trap Art is a pioneer in their industry. Located in the Florida Keys, they take old and unusable lobster traps and recycle them, creating unique weathered picture frames from the wood. Because the traps are underwater, the wood gets very rustic from not only the water, but the marine animals that live on the trap. The wood, which varies from fisherman to fisherman, ages differently, making each frame a unique piece of art.
Most of the traps have been used for over 5 seasons in the Florida Keys lobster business. The season runs from August 6th through April 1st each year. During the off season, the lobstermen repair the broken traps and remove any old wood that will not make it through the next season. This repair wood is also used to make the picture frames. Nadine and Glenn collect the loose wood from Key West to Key Largo every year. They store the wood slats in a large warehouse until it is needed to make the picture frames. They also collect the whole lobster traps that cannot be repaired. These whole traps are dismantled, and the wood is placed with the loose wood collected during the repair season. “By recycling the lobster pots, we keep the landfills from being the final resting place for these traps” explains Nadine Lahti, co-founder of the company.
Nadine and Glenn are also both artists and they put their Original Paintings in these nautical frames. “It is like getting 2 pieces of artwork in one!” according to Glenn Lahti, the other partner in the company. Nadine paints mostly birds, fish, and other animals that are indigenous to the Florida Keys. Her Blue Herons, Roseate Spoonbills, Egrets, Turtles, and other game fish are very detailed. Glenn, on the other hand, paints local seascapes and landscapes usually putting in at least one Palm Tree, his trademark. He has also done several of the Florida Keys reef lighthouses.
